When the hand history file says "is all-in", change that to "calls [amount]" or "raises [amount]" or, yeah, you get the picture. Then write (all-in) next to the raise in the post later. Notice the extra space that has to be removed in front of " all-in" in the history file. (This is something I have to do with hand histories from empire, I don't know of anything else.)

If I do this, it doesn't mess up stuff for me. Not horribly at least.
